Job Summary and key responsibilities:

Reporting to the Team Manager/Head of Centre, Leaders are seeking a Property Inventory Clerk to join our dedicated and dynamic team based in Cambridge. As a Property Inventory Clerk, experience is beneficial but not essential. You will be responsible for carrying out detailed Inventory reports to ensure a smooth check-in/check-out process for our tenants and landlords as well as carrying out mid-term inspections to ensure our properties are kept in the highest condition. Whilst working alongside a team, the majority of this role will be lone standing, therefore you will need to be confident with working independently.

Key Responsibilities:

  • To arrange and book property inspections with tenants, to conduct on average 15 inspections or 5-10 inventories each day
  • To confirm visits prior to attending
  • Collection & return of keys from local offices
  • Conduct inspections, ensuring to check:
    - External condition of Property
    - Communal areas (if applicable)
    - Noting Internal condition
    - Ensuring property meets with current legislation
    - Ensuring property is free from risk
  • Completing report and Approval process
  • Feeding back to property manager any maintenance issues
  • Submitting report to both Landlord and Tenants, with written summery, placing a call prior if issues are noted.
  • Diarising follow up for Property manager
